I assume you are trying to connect wireless?
Open a command prompt as administrator and press enter after each command below:
Netsh int ip reset c:\resetlog.txt
netsh winsoc reset catalog
netsh dump
netsh winsoc reset
Reboot the computer and see if you have connectivity.
